Hallmark store to close in Rostraver Township

Employees at Rostraver Township Hallmark are working to save the store before its closure Oct. 1.
Store manager Helen Tretinik, who also serves as regional supervisor for all stores owned by R & D Business Centers, has asked patrons and Belle Vernon area residents to support their efforts.
“They’re closing down all 14 stores, but the biggest impact will definitely be felt in Belle Vernon and Mt. Pleasant for our communities,” Tretinik said. “We’re privately owned, not like corporate stores, so we’ve always seemed to have a bigger impact on our customers. We feel more like home for them.”
Pittsburgh-based R & D Business Centers expanded from five to 14 stores and more than 100 employees in less than five years, Tretinik said, ultimately leading to the closures.
“There’s been some heavy growth in this particular chain, and for those newer stores that were weak in the chain, it was a bit like drowning-person syndrome,” she said. “If you hang on, you’re going to bring down the person trying to save you.
“Bigger stores like this one just couldn’t help the weaker stores, and the company couldn’t get them closed down fast enough, so we were all affected.
